Violet Konkle - THE NORTH Director
Director
Ms. Violet A.M. Konkle is the Independent Director of the company. Ms. Konkle is the past President and Chief Executive Officer of The Brick Ltd. Prior to joining The Brick in 2010 as President Business Support she held a number of positions with Walmart Canada including Chief Operating Officer and Chief Customer Officer. Ms. Konkle also held a number of senior executive positions with Loblaw Companies Ltd. including Executive Vice President Atlantic Wholesale Division since 2014.

THE NORTH Management Efficiency
The company has return on total asset (ROA) of 8.61 % which means that it generated a profit of $8.61 on every $100 spent on assets. This is normal as compared to the sector avarege. Similarly, it shows a return on equity (ROE) of 18.74 %, meaning that it generated $18.74 on every $100 dollars invested by stockholders. THE NORTH's management efficiency ratios could be used to measure how well THE NORTH manages its routine affairs as well as how well it operates its assets and liabilities.The company has accumulated 217.37 M in total debt with debt to equity ratio (D/E) of 73.7, indicating the company may have difficulties to generate enough cash to satisfy its financial obligations. THE NORTH WEST has a current ratio of 2.15, suggesting that it is liquid and has the ability to pay its financial obligations in time and when they become due.
